What is the main difference between Meituan and Rappi?
Meituan and Rappi are regional super‑app marketplaces that converge on on‑demand delivery, local commerce and in‑app advertising. Both aggregate consumer demand and monetise merchants, but Meituan emphasises logistics scale, dense merchant distribution and first‑party commerce data in China, while Rappi targets Latin America with stronger embedded payments, fintech services and subscription monetisation. The core differentiator is Meituan’s logistics/data advantage versus Rappi’s payments/fintech focus.
How do the features of Meituan and Rappi compare?
Both Meituan and Rappi provide multi‑sided marketplace products: consumer apps, merchant onboarding, order fulfilment orchestration, in‑app advertising and subscription tiers. Overlap covers delivery coordination, listings and merchant monetisation. Meituan’s product strengths lie in large‑scale logistics, fulfilment execution and first‑party commerce data for targeting. Rappi compensates with integrated payments, embedded financial products and fintech services that expand monetisation beyond pure commerce.
